Chelsea host Hull City at Stamford Bridge on Saturday looking to respond to their first Premier League defeat under Xabi Alonso, a 2-1 loss at Arsenal last weekend.
The Blues needed a dramatic second-half turnaround to beat Leeds United 6-3 in the EFL Cup in midweek after trailing at the break, and sit fourth in the table, three points off the pace. Alonso’s side have never lost to Hull in 10 previous Premier League meetings, but their defensive form remains a concern heading into the weekend.
Jordan Henderson (wrist) and Emmanuel Emegha (muscle) continue their recoveries, and Moises Caicedo remains unavailable after Alonso ruled him out on Friday, saying it is “not the moment to take the risk with him.” Marco Palestra is also sidelined. Romeo Lavia’s absence from the matchday squad in midweek was a rotation decision rather than an injury concern, and the midfielder is expected to be available.
Levi Colwill is set for another start in a back three after Alonso allayed fitness fears following the EFL Cup win, with Maxence Lacroix, Josh Acheampong and Wesley Fofana also competing for places in defence. Morgan Rogers, who provided four assists as a substitute against Leeds, is expected to earn a recall, while Cole Palmer — who scored twice in midweek — is set to support central striker Joao Pedro.
Chelsea possible starting XI (3-4-2-1): Martinez; Acheampong, Lacroix, Colwill; Neto, James, Lavia, Hato; Rogers, Palmer; Pedro
The Premier League match kicks off at 15:00 on Saturday, 12 September 2026.
The match is not being broadcast live on television in the UK, with the fixture falling inside the traditional Saturday 3pm blackout.
